This program trains students in the art of handling and preparing food for restaurants and hotels. They learn how to plan menus, determine the size of portions, and select, store and prepare food.

We provide an in depth, hands-on education in cooking, baking, and dining room management supported by related classroom curriculum and activities. Keefe’s student run restaurant, the East Side Room, is open four days a week, providing real-world experience in a state of the art classroom facility.

Students receive certifications from the National Restaurant Association in Serv/Safe and from the American Culinary Federation, helping further their education after graduation both in college and upon entering the workforce.
